Session abstract
Red Hat Ansible Tower is a wonderful thing... until it gets overburdened with too many playbooks trying to execute at once. But it doesn't have to be that way. Hear about simple things you can do to optimize the performance of your playbooks within Ansible Tower and from the command line. From Ansible configuration itself to trips and tricks within playbooks, see how to make every line count.
